Abstract

A hands-on educational module was created to illustrate the scope of chemical engineering. Students are taught fundamental concepts that they integrate in a laboratory experience designing and fabricating a ‘plant-on-a-chip’ microfluidic device capable of continuous processing of reactive flows. Students gain insight into chemical engineering principles in the context of process scale-down, including extracting and extending reaction kinetics from bench to microfluidic-scale while accounting for the need for enhanced mixing within laminar fluid flow.
